Cloverleaf is 10-0 against Springfield since October of 2019, and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Thursday. The Cloverleaf Colts have the luxury of staying home for another game and will welcome the Springfield Spartans at 6:30 p.m. Springfield took a loss in their last contest and will be looking to turn the tables on Cloverleaf, who comes in off a win.
Cloverleaf will bounce into Thursday's matchup after beating Tallmadge, who they hadn't topped in three consecutive meetings. Cloverleaf walked away with a 3-1 win over Tallmadge on Wednesday. The victory was some much needed relief for the Colts as it spelled an end to their three-game losing streak.
After all that action, the final score was 25-23, 30-28, 21-25, 25-21.
Meanwhile, Springfield lost 3-0 to Woodridge on Tuesday. The Spartans have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-10, 25-20, 27-25.
Cloverleaf's win ended a three-game drought at home and bumped them up to 7-5. As for Springfield, their defeat dropped their record down to 6-6.
Cloverleaf was able to grind out a solid victory over Springfield in their previous matchup back in August, winning 3-1. Will Cloverleaf repeat their success, or does Springfield have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
